Transaction 21a34ca3ea2ad3e0a442fdcde6b16491c37026636acf74f51907ad14ba607837

2 Input
2 Outputs
  • 21a34ca3ea2ad3e0a442fdcde6b16491c37026636acf74f51907ad14ba607837:0
  • value  1091263
    address  3DS7AH2mXyUcoHV4WGPrzyR8YV2oPbMQA6
  • 21a34ca3ea2ad3e0a442fdcde6b16491c37026636acf74f51907ad14ba607837:1
  • value  992393
    address  1FHzmj3rSAPt1jVLg3srhJZjj9WdxNVyGY